How will you CONTRIBUTE and GROW?

The Plant Operator Technicians main responsibility is to monitor, control, and maintain the N2O process within normal operating parameters and perform quality tests on LCO2 product to ensure compliance with quality and food safety requirements.

In particular, you will:

  • Safe start-up, shutdown, and efficient operation of the liquid N20 plant

  • Performs assigned repairs and installations on all plant production equipment

  • Performs quality tests on N2O product per Airgas procedures

  • Is trained in food safety procedures and will operate the facility in compliance with the food safety policy.

  • Completes preventive maintenance as assigned.

  • Knows and complies with all safety and quality policies and procedures.

  • Performs equipment inspections to ensure proper operation and safety

  • Communicates equipment operation and repair functions with production management

  • Identifies and communicates safety hazards and quality deficiencies to production management.

  • Monitors and records operational data to written logs and software systems.

  • Clean-up as required including, but not limited to, sweeping, washing, painting, trash removal and pick-up.

About Airgas

Airgas, an Air Liquide company, is a leading U.S. supplier of industrial, medical and specialty gases, as well as hardgoods and related products; one of the largest U.S. suppliers of safety products.

Through the passion and diversity of its 18,000 associates, Airgas fosters a culture of safety, customer success, sustainability and innovation. Airgas associates are empowered to share ideas, take initiative and make decisions.

Airgas is a subsidiary of Air Liquide, a world leader in gases, technologies and services for Industry and Health. Air Liquide is present in 78 countries with approximately 64,500 associates globally.
